What's interesting in the light of this discussion is the way the EA games are listed here.
Ultima is listed as a registered trademark (circled R) , the other games are listed as unregistered trademarks (TM).
Not many other games here are listed as such.
To me it suggests that EA keeps open any option to make a new game based upon any of their old games.
I'd say a third person perspective would be just the thing. Think Gears of War, but perhaps with the camera pulled slightly further back. Modern day gamers wouldn't go for an isometric view in a full price retail release, so that's the closest we'd get to mimicking the old games.

From there, it's just a question of getting level design, weapons and story (such as it is) remotely interesting.

An FPS would work too of course, but I've increasingly come of the view that third person perspective ironically makes it easier to identify with your character.

The retro type game as a donwloadable title would defnitely work. They're all the rage nowadays after all.

Or as a handheld title. Imagine a remake or straight up sequel on the 3DS for example, with the classic view on the top screen and map/inventory/missio objectives on the bottom screen (you have to have a map, modern day gamers wouldn't play it otherwise). With the analog pad, four face buttons and shoulder buttons for sidestepping/rolling, controls would be smooth as butter (as much as I love this game, the controls are just stupidly stiff).
